WORLD ARMAMENTS
COST DURING 1939 ESTIMATE OF £4,000,000,000 WASHINGTON, July 30. According to a computation by the Foreign Office Policy Association, the leading world Powers will spend 20,000,000,000 dollars (over £4,000,000,000) on armaments and defence during 1939.
